China touts open-source AI as “shared for all humanity”—but is it quietly walking it back?

Intelrift Intelligence Desk·Sunday, July 19, 2026 at 03:45 AMGlobal (China-led AI policy; U.S. connected vehicles; India tech leadership; Colombia-linked trafficking case)6 articles · 5 sourcesLIVE

China’s leadership is publicly framing open-source AI as a “shared asset for all humanity,” explicitly pointing to users in less wealthy countries as beneficiaries. However, reporting suggests that Chinese officials are now “reviewing” that commitment to AI openness, implying a possible shift from broad sharing toward tighter control. The juxtaposition matters because it signals a strategic recalibration: China wants legitimacy and influence in the global AI ecosystem while retaining leverage over model access, deployment, and compliance. In parallel, the broader news flow shows AI moving from policy slogans into high-stakes applications and risks, from fraud schemes to autonomous mobility. Geopolitically, the tension is about who sets the rules for frontier AI diffusion—open communities or state-managed ecosystems. If China tightens openness, it could reduce the bargaining power of smaller countries that rely on accessible tools, while strengthening China’s ability to shape standards, procurement, and talent pipelines. That would also affect how other powers interpret China’s “shared asset” narrative: as genuine capacity-building or as a soft-power bridge that can be reversed when strategic interests change. Market and economic implications are likely to concentrate in AI software and compute, cybersecurity, and connected-vehicle supply chains. China’s potential pivot on open-source AI could influence demand for model hosting, developer tooling, and compliance services, while also affecting sentiment around open ecosystems versus proprietary control. Separately, reports about over-the-air (OTA) cybersecurity risks in autos point to rising costs for automotive cybersecurity testing, secure update infrastructure, and incident response—an area that can lift spending in security vendors and insurers. The autonomous-vehicle angle in the U.S. also hints at operational risk premiums for fleets and emergency services, even if the immediate market impact is more sentiment-driven than commodity-driven. What to watch next is whether China formalizes any new rules that narrow open-source licensing, restrict “frontier” model weights, or impose additional governance requirements on downstream use. In parallel, investors and policymakers should track whether connected-car standards bodies accelerate OTA security mandates and whether regulators tighten requirements for secure update channels and incident reporting. On the criminal side, the Cambodia-linked scam network involving AI-enabled fraud underscores the likelihood of more cross-border trafficking cases and calls for “humanitarian repatriation” mechanisms, which can become a political flashpoint. Key trigger points include new Chinese AI governance announcements, major OTA vulnerability disclosures, and any high-profile autonomous-vehicle safety incidents that force changes to deployment policies.
